Biography
        My name is Darab Abdollahi, a veterinarian from Iran, my main activity was involved with the Iran Veterinary Organization (IVO). I retired 3 years ago following 33 years of experience.  I have significantly contributed to veterinary science, particularly in studying infectious diseases affecting livestock in Iran. Furthermore, I was involved with the European Commission for the Control of Foot-and-Mouth Disease (EuFMD) in Iran. Participated in and facilitated various workshops organized by EuFMD. Through EuFMD, I collaborate with experts from different countries, sharing knowledge and best practices to enhance FMD control measures.
Now I work with Twora company (a private veterinary agency) as a technical advisor and Specialist focusing on health and management of animal diseases, leveraging my extensive experience and expertise in veterinary science.  Research interests
